philipchevron wrote:MultipleMike wrote:Have they always played "White City", though? I know they've done "Body of an American" in reunion tours...
Then again, my only source is the live disc from the Ultimate Collection. No White City, but BoaA was included.
On a side note, the entire live disc was a stellar performance! Possibly the best live recording I've ever heard...
Thank you, we worked hard to make it sound great and, unlike most live albums, there is not a single replaced or repaired performance.
White City, The Parting Glass, Medley and Star Of The County Down were left off the album for reasons of space.
I think we have always done White City when we've done our full 2 hour show (ie, not at festivals) but that may change as we are, in any case, going to shake up the set a little for December.
